Description

Terrace of three three-bay single-storey houses, built c.1820, with abutting two-storey outbuilding to north. Set back from road. Pitched slate roofs with red brick chimneystacks and some cast-iron rainwater goods. Lime-washed walls with exposed stone walls in places. Roughcast rendered wall to outbuilding. Timber sash windows with painted sills, rectangular slit openings to outbuilding. Square-headed door openings with timber battened doors. Grass verge to front of site.

Appraisal

Though modest in design and small in stature, these cottages create a terrace of similar structures that contribute to Crinkill's streetscape. Their façades are enlivened by their timber sash windows and battened doors.
